| Rank | State | Average salary | Lowest 10% earn | Population | Job count |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| California | $89,307 | $53,000 | 39,536,653 | 3,683 |
| 2 | Massachusetts | $85,743 | $48,000 | 6,859,819 | 927 |
| 3 | Nevada | $89,769 | $54,000 | 2,998,039 | 184 |
| 4 | Oregon | $77,242 | $48,000 | 4,142,776 | 534 |
| 5 | Delaware | $82,300 | $48,000 | 961,939 | 114 |
| 6 | New Hampshire | $82,762 | $47,000 | 1,342,795 | 148 |
| 7 | Arizona | $79,007 | $48,000 | 7,016,270 | 522 |
| 8 | New Jersey | $78,275 | $45,000 | 9,005,644 | 913 |
| 9 | Washington | $76,162 | $48,000 | 7,405,743 | 801 |
| 10 | Vermont | $78,132 | $44,000 | 623,657 | 73 |
| 11 | Idaho | $84,388 | $53,000 | 1,716,943 | 93 |
| 12 | Rhode Island | $72,409 | $41,000 | 1,059,639 | 130 |
| 13 | North Dakota | $73,870 | $49,000 | 755,393 | 70 |
| 14 | New York | $72,941 | $42,000 | 19,849,399 | 1,803 |
| 15 | Maryland | $79,860 | $46,000 | 6,052,177 | 583 |
| 16 | Alaska | $76,219 | $53,000 | 739,795 | 60 |
| 17 | New Mexico | $76,743 | $47,000 | 2,088,070 | 109 |
| 18 | Connecticut | $70,363 | $40,000 | 3,588,184 | 305 |
| 19 | District of Columbia | $69,271 | $40,000 | 693,972 | 395 |
| 20 | Utah | $62,945 | $39,000 | 3,101,833 | 395 |
| 21 | Pennsylvania | $64,021 | $37,000 | 12,805,537 | 1,130 |
| 22 | South Dakota | $71,189 | $47,000 | 869,666 | 48 |
| 23 | Illinois | $63,238 | $39,000 | 12,802,023 | 1,345 |
| 24 | Iowa | $68,817 | $44,000 | 3,145,711 | 156 |
| 25 | Nebraska | $67,298 | $44,000 | 1,920,076 | 120 |
| 26 | Virginia | $64,010 | $37,000 | 8,470,020 | 992 |
| 27 | Minnesota | $64,599 | $42,000 | 5,576,606 | 530 |
| 28 | Ohio | $61,690 | $37,000 | 11,658,609 | 852 |
| 29 | Kansas | $65,934 | $42,000 | 2,913,123 | 151 |
| 30 | Arkansas | $61,851 | $38,000 | 3,004,279 | 220 |
| 31 | Texas | $58,834 | $35,000 | 28,304,596 | 2,088 |
| 32 | Wisconsin | $62,909 | $39,000 | 5,795,483 | 361 |
| 33 | North Carolina | $58,829 | $35,000 | 10,273,419 | 913 |
| 34 | Montana | $61,923 | $40,000 | 1,050,493 | 81 |
| 35 | Maine | $60,446 | $33,000 | 1,335,907 | 96 |
| 36 | Missouri | $60,793 | $38,000 | 6,113,532 | 431 |
| 37 | Hawaii | $66,692 | $49,000 | 1,427,538 | 50 |
| 38 | Florida | $56,335 | $33,000 | 20,984,400 | 1,419 |
| 39 | Colorado | $59,131 | $38,000 | 5,607,154 | 492 |
| 40 | Michigan | $56,650 | $34,000 | 9,962,311 | 601 |
| 41 | Wyoming | $58,826 | $38,000 | 579,315 | 22 |
| 42 | Tennessee | $53,388 | $33,000 | 6,715,984 | 476 |
| 43 | Georgia | $51,782 | $31,000 | 10,429,379 | 1,025 |
| 44 | Indiana | $54,823 | $34,000 | 6,666,818 | 444 |
| 45 | West Virginia | $54,331 | $32,000 | 1,815,857 | 69 |
| 46 | Kentucky | $52,667 | $32,000 | 4,454,189 | 245 |
| 47 | Alabama | $48,075 | $29,000 | 4,874,747 | 279 |
| 48 | South Carolina | $44,600 | $27,000 | 5,024,369 | 355 |
| 49 | Louisiana | $46,754 | $28,000 | 4,684,333 | 177 |
| 50 | Oklahoma | $48,006 | $30,000 | 3,930,864 | 129 |
| 51 | Mississippi | $45,293 | $28,000 | 2,984,100 | 81 |
